What Is A Database
The distribution license of the software permits users to resell binaries, because of open source. The advanced nature of the tool slows down the insertion of small databases. Whether you run a small or a longtime enterprise, it might be wise to search for a DBMS with multiple database choices. From sophistication to enhanced scalability, your selection ought to complement the nature of your corporation product or service. Over the years, programmers and trade specialists have shared their love for the DMBS primarily because of a defined course of that reduces data redundancy and shops data effectively. The nature of the DBMS, however, can be industrial or built-in with unique options.
When objects are sometimes related, it is a lookup relationship. As talked about when we outlined ACID, a core part of a relational database is consistency. We explore the features, uses, and advantages of a relational database below. Before we get into the concept of a database, we should first understand what data is. Put simply, data are items of data or facts related to the thing being thought-about. For instance, examples of data referring to a person can be the person’s name, age, peak, weight, ethnicity, hair colour, and birthdate.
These reviews comprise a wealthy array of company history and enterprise descriptions, and in-depth financial statements. The collection is searchable by company name, year, or handbook kind. Global in scope, Factiva is a very highly effective analysis software providing data on corporations, stock quotes, and business/financial news.
DBMS optimizes the group of information by following a database schema design method referred to as normalization, which splits a big desk into smaller tables when any of its attributes have redundancy in values. DBMS supply many advantages over traditional file methods, together with flexibility and a more complicated backup system. These schemas do not essentially indicate the ways that the datafiles are stored physically. Instead, schema objects are stored logically within a tablespace. The database administrator can specify how much space to assign to a specific object within a datafile. At essentially the most fundamental level, a database schema signifies which tables or relations make up the database, as nicely as the fields included on each desk.
In this chapter, we realized about the function that information and databases play in the context of knowledge techniques. Data is made up of small facts and knowledge without context. Knowledge is gained when info is consumed and used for choice making. Relational databases are the most widely used type of database, the place knowledge is structured into tables and all tables have to be related to one another by way of unique identifiers. A knowledge warehouse is a special form of database that takes data from other databases in an enterprise and organizes it for analysis. Data mining is the process of looking for patterns and relationships in giant data units.
Read on to find out more about database schemas and the way they’re used. The power of CoScale lies in monitoring and optimizing massive scale information tasks. The key performance indicator window can be shared throughout a quantity of users.
Relational databases use SQL in their user and software program interfaces. A new information category can easily be added to a relational database with out having to change the prevailing functions. A relational database management system is used to store, manage, question and retrieve information in a relational database. The aim of logical design, also referred to as data modeling, is to design the schema of the database and all the mandatory subschemas. A relational database will encompass tables , every of which describes only the attributes of a selected class of entities. Logical design begins with figuring out the entity lessons to be represented in the database and establishing relationships between pairs of these entities.
In the navigational method, all of this data can be placed in a single variable-length record. In the relational approach, the information would be normalized right into a person table, an tackle table and a telephone quantity table . Records would be created in these optional tables only if the address or phone numbers have which phase of the sdlc gathers business requirements? been really supplied. The time period metadata may be understood as “data about knowledge.” For instance, when looking at one of the values of Year of Birth within the Students table, the data itself may be “1992”. The metadata about that value could be the sphere name Year of Birth, the time it was final updated, and the data sort .
Isolation is important to reaching concurrency control and makes certain each transaction is impartial unto itself. Durability requires that the entire adjustments made to the database be everlasting as soon as a transaction is successfully accomplished. Foreign key attributes usually are not considered to be owned by the entities to which they migrate, as a result of they’re reflections of attributes within the parent entities.